Become a priestess of the Morrigan and build a personalized devotional practice with this profound book on deepening your connection to her. Through stories, prayers, and rituals for groups and solitaries, Priestess of the Morrigan shows you how to serve the Great Queen and enhance your spiritual journey. Explore the true nature of the Morrigan, discover what it means to channel her voice, and learn about her role in prophecies and curse work. Create your own unique tradition with this book s ritual-building advice and guidelines for developing a yearly cycle of celebrations. Stephanie Woodfield, a devotee to the Great Queen for over twenty years, uses her personal triumphs and challenges as beacons for your path to becoming a priestess of the Morrigan.

STEPHANIE WOODFIELD (Orlando, FL) has been a practicing Witch and priestess for more than twenty years. She is the founder of Morrigu s Daughters, a women s networking group for Morrigan devotees, and she organizes and owns the Morrigan s Call Retreat, an event that focuses on the Morrigan.
